    Supernumber Theory and Quantum Superposition Phenomena
    Author(s): Zhi Li* and Hua Li

    Hyperreal numbers are a field encompassing real numbers, infinitesimals, and infinities. In the hyperreal number system, infinitesimals are not equal to zero, and operations can be performed on infinitesimals and infinities. Based on hyperreal number theory, this paper discovers that multi-level radicals that cannot be simplified have no definite value, varying in size; these can be called quantum numbers or inaccurate numbers. A special type of multi-level radical can exhibit quantum superposition phenomena similar to those in the physical world. This allows the hyperreal number system to be extended to a supernumber system, a field encompassing real numbers, infinitesimals, infinities, and inaccurate numbers.
